#e49eed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e49eed is composed of 89.4% red, 62%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 293.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 77.5%. #e49eed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c93ddb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#e49eed color description : Very soft magenta.

#e49eed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e49eed has RGB values of R:228, G:158,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14982893.

Hex triplet e49eed #e49eed
RGB Decimal 228, 158, 237 rgb(228,158,237)
RGB Percent 89.4, 62, 92.9 rgb(89.4%,62%,92.9%)
CMYK 4, 33, 0, 7
HSL 293.2°, 68.7, 77.5 hsl(293.2,68.7%,77.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 293.2°, 33.3, 92.9
Web Safe cc99ff #cc99ff
CIE-LAB 74.231, 38.813, -29.351
XYZ 59.506, 47.064, 86.066
xyY 0.309, 0.244, 47.064
CIE-LCH 74.231, 48.661, 322.902
CIE-LUV 74.231, 33.468, -52.643
Hunter-Lab 68.603, 34.775, -26.36
Binary 11100100, 10011110, 11101101

Shades and Tints of #e49eed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#fbf1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e49eed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9c1ca is the less saturated color, while #f28cff is the most saturated one.
